Should you play it?

Battle against Fahrul's tyrannical Queen alone or as a party of four players in the sequel to For The King, the massively popular turn-based roguelite tabletop RPG. Will you unravel the once beloved Queen's terrible secret?

What works
  • Engaging tactical combat
  • Strong cooperative multiplayer
  • High replayability with procedural generation
  • Rich fantasy setting
Things to keep in mind
  • Limited competitive features
  • Some players may find difficulty spikes challenging
  • Not much emphasis on social or status features
